Motor Vehicle Body, Paint and Interior Repair in Australia industry analysis

Most revenue generated by the Motor Vehicle Body, Paint and Interior Repair industry derives from repairs performed on motor vehicles damaged in accidents. The industry also includes businesses that provide elective services, like spray painting and car washing. Despite more motor vehicle accidents, panelbeaters have struggled to maintain repair throughput because of the increased complexity of vehicles and a tight labour market, decreasing revenue. The COVID-19 pandemic caused revenue to plummet over the three years through 2021-22, as restrictions on movement and gatherings sharply reduced motor vehicle activity. Overall, industry revenue is expected to drop at an annualised 1.8% over the five years through 2024-25, to $9.1 billion. This trend includes an anticipated decline of 1.7% in 2024-25, as revenue is impacted by increased new car sales and difficult economic conditions, which are limiting elective repairs and services.

Trends and Insights

  • Motor vehicle repair firms have faced rising input costs that have weighed on margins. Firms have struggled to pass these costs on because of ongoing pricing agreements with insurers.
  • Pricing agreements with insurers have limited smash repair shops’ ability to adjust pricing. Firms have struggled to raise prices in line with inflation because of their ongoing pricing agreements with insurers.
  • High levels of congestion and population density make Victoria a key market for panelbeaters. Congested roads are a major driver of motor vehicle accidents, which boosts demand for industry services.
  • Larger motor vehicle repairers rely on insurers to maintain repair volumes and margins. Repairers that have lost access to preferred body shop status among insurers have struggled to maximise capacity utilisation, forcing some to sell their business after becoming unprofitable.

Safer vehicles are set to reduce collisions and dampen demand for repair services

  • New vehicles with safety, crash avoidance and driverless technology will become increasingly common on Australian roads. This trend will reduce the frequency and severity of motor vehicle accidents occurring in Australia.

About this industry

Industry definition

Industry companies primarily repair, panelbeat or spray paint damaged or smashed motor vehicles. The industry also includes companies that replace, repair or tint motor vehicle glass, and companies that perform interior or upholstery repairs, car wash or cleaning services.
